What you need to know
How will I study?

Practical element include: Health & Safety, brickwork, blockwork, carpentry & joinery, painting & Decorating, plumbing and electrical, all these units will be backed up with theoretical knowledge. All our learners are expected to improve their current levels of English and Maths this may be either Functional skills or GCSE pending on your current level, these skills are to a successful career in the construction industry
How will I be taught?

Practical training is delivered by demonstration, drawings or sometimes written instructions. Theory is mainly delivered in a classroom environment but is also explored within the practical workshops. All learners preferred learning styles will be catered for.
How will I be assessed?

On going practical assessments and multiple choice question papers.
